A Brief History of Flame Tattoos

The symbolism of fire has been deeply ingrained in human culture since the dawn of civilization. Fire represents warmth, light, and protection, but also danger and destruction. In ancient times, fire was often associated with gods and deities, holding a prominent place in mythology and religious rituals. The use of fire imagery in tattoos can be traced back to various cultures, with each imbuing it with their own unique interpretations.

In modern tattooing, flame tattoos gained popularity in the mid-20th century, particularly among bikers, sailors, and members of the military. For these groups, flames often represented courage, resilience, and a rebellious spirit. The imagery has evolved over time, incorporating various styles and techniques, making flame tattoos a timeless and adaptable choice.

Symbolism and Meaning Behind Flame Tattoos

The meaning of a flame tattoo can be highly personal and subjective, depending on the individual’s experiences and beliefs. However, certain common interpretations are widely recognized:

  • Passion and Desire: Flames are often associated with intense emotions, particularly love, desire, and passion. A flame tattoo can represent a burning desire for something or someone, or a passionate approach to life.
  • Transformation and Rebirth: Fire is a transformative force, capable of consuming and destroying, but also purifying and renewing. A flame tattoo can symbolize personal growth, overcoming obstacles, and emerging stronger from adversity.
  • Strength and Resilience: Flames can withstand harsh conditions and continue to burn brightly. A flame tattoo can represent inner strength, resilience in the face of challenges, and the ability to persevere.
  • Destruction and Chaos: Fire can also be destructive and chaotic. A flame tattoo can symbolize a rebellious spirit, a rejection of societal norms, or a willingness to embrace the unpredictable nature of life.
  • Remembrance: A flame tattoo can act as a memorial, representing someone who has passed away, their memory burning brightly in the heart of the wearer.

Popular Flame Tattoo Designs and Ideas

The possibilities for flame tattoo ideas are virtually limitless. Here are some popular design concepts to consider:

Traditional Flame Tattoos

Traditional flame tattoos often feature bold lines, vibrant colors (typically red, orange, and yellow), and a simple, stylized design. These tattoos are often associated with classic American tattoo art and evoke a sense of nostalgia.

Realistic Flame Tattoos

Realistic flame tattoos aim to capture the intricate details and dynamic movement of real flames. These tattoos require a skilled artist with expertise in shading and color blending to create a lifelike effect. They often incorporate elements of smoke and ash to enhance the realism.

Tribal Flame Tattoos

Tribal flame tattoos incorporate traditional tribal patterns and motifs into the flame design. These tattoos often represent ancestry, heritage, and a connection to the natural world. They can be customized with different tribal symbols to create a unique and meaningful design.

Heart with Flames Tattoo

A heart engulfed in flames symbolizes passionate love, intense desire, or a love that has been tested by fire. This design is a classic representation of romantic love and can be customized with different colors, styles, and embellishments.

Skull with Flames Tattoo

A skull surrounded by flames represents mortality, danger, and a rebellious spirit. This design is often associated with bikers, rockers, and those who embrace a darker aesthetic. It can also symbolize overcoming fear and embracing the impermanence of life.

Dragon with Flames Tattoo

A dragon breathing fire represents power, strength, and transformation. Dragons are mythical creatures that embody both destruction and creation. This design is often chosen by those who seek to embody these qualities in their own lives. [See also: Dragon Tattoo Meanings]

Phoenix with Flames Tattoo

A phoenix rising from the ashes is a powerful symbol of rebirth, renewal, and overcoming adversity. The phoenix is a mythical bird that is consumed by flames and then reborn from the ashes. This design is often chosen by those who have experienced significant challenges in their lives and have emerged stronger and wiser.

Candle Flame Tattoo

A candle flame represents hope, guidance, and remembrance. Unlike a raging fire, a candle flame is a gentle and controlled source of light. This design can symbolize inner peace, spiritual enlightenment, or a tribute to a loved one. The size and style of the candle can be varied to personalize the tattoo.

Abstract Flame Tattoos

Abstract flame tattoos allow for greater artistic expression and creativity. These tattoos can incorporate geometric shapes, swirling lines, and unconventional color palettes to create a unique and visually striking design. They often focus on the essence of fire rather than a literal representation.

Placement Considerations for Flame Tattoos

The placement of a flame tattoo can significantly impact its overall appearance and meaning. Here are some popular placement options:

  • Arm: The arm is a versatile location for flame tattoos, allowing for both small and large designs. A flame tattoo on the bicep can emphasize strength, while a flame tattoo on the forearm can be easily visible.
  • Leg: The leg provides ample space for larger, more elaborate flame tattoos. A flame tattoo on the thigh can be a bold and eye-catching statement, while a flame tattoo on the calf can be more subtle.
  • Back: The back is an ideal canvas for larger flame tattoo designs, allowing for intricate details and dramatic compositions. A flame tattoo on the back can symbolize strength, protection, and a connection to the spiritual realm.
  • Chest: A flame tattoo on the chest can represent passion, love, and inner strength. This placement is often chosen for designs that are deeply personal and meaningful.
  • Shoulder: The shoulder is a classic location for flame tattoos, particularly for traditional designs. A flame tattoo on the shoulder can symbolize courage, resilience, and a rebellious spirit.
  • Fingers: Small flame tattoos can be placed on fingers, often symbolizing a burning passion or a constant reminder of inner fire.

Aftercare for Flame Tattoos

Proper aftercare is essential for ensuring that your flame tattoo heals properly and maintains its vibrant colors. Follow your tattoo artist’s instructions carefully, which typically include:

  • Keeping the tattoo clean and dry.
  • Applying a thin layer of unscented moisturizer.
  • Avoiding direct sunlight and excessive sweating.
  • Avoiding soaking the tattoo in water (e.g., swimming, bathing) for the first few weeks.
  • Avoiding picking or scratching the tattoo.

By following these aftercare guidelines, you can help ensure that your flame tattoo heals beautifully and remains a vibrant symbol of your personal journey.
